Originated from Malaysia especially the state of Sabah, I'm probably familiar with this week's theme, "Rainforest". It's like the trademark of Borneo island, which people from West Malaysia refers as 'jungle'. I'm proud of growing up in this 'jungle', we don't live on top of trees by the way.
If anyone have been to jungle trekking in a tropical forest, you should know how amazing are the wildlife, plants and animals that live in it (minus the mosquitoes and leeches). Also, I personally think that the song of nature is actually very comforting. The sound of birds chirping, river flowing, wind passing through the leaves and crickets, they are all wonderful sounds.
In this soundshoot, I'm doing the nostalgic feeling of adventure in a tropical forest with friends. I was imagining... walking through the narrow path in the jungle, where everyone have to look back occasionally to make sure no one's missing. Stepping over mud, resting at the riverside, taking pictures with random animals and plants, those are definitely great memories.

Guitar plucking serves well as accompaniment, providing a sense of 'keep going'. Piano sprinkle as main lead, reminiscing about nostalgic adventures. Pan flute and bongo add on for the urban sound, remote enough from city/town to forget those life problems. Most importantly, some sound effects of the song of nature, the animals and river which I really love. There goes my recipe of my "rainforest" track, Garden of Life, a beautiful art and creation of God to bless our land
